Well, I met the same issue with you. I thought it was caused by incompatible versions of Keras & Tensorflow. I used to use the latest version of tensorflow on macOS, the same error message came out.
I reinstalled Keras==2.0.6 & Tensorflow==1.15.0, it works fine now.
